Svar

Hvad er tagging i bitbucket?

Hvad er tagging i bitbucket? Tags markerer en specifik forpligtelse på et tidspunkt i din lagerhistorik. Når du tagger en commit, inkluderer du alle ændringerne før den. Bitbucket Cloud understøtter tags til Git repositories. Du kan oprette et tag i Bitbucket eller lokalt og skubbe det til Bitbucket.

Hvad er tagging i Git? Tags er referencer, der peger på specifikke punkter i Git-historien. Tagging bruges generelt til at fange et punkt i historien, der bruges til en markeret versionsudgivelse (dvs. v1. 0.1). Et mærke er som en gren, der ikke ændrer sig. I modsætning til filialer har tags, efter at de er blevet oprettet, ingen yderligere historie med commits.

Hvordan ser jeg tags i bitbucket? 1 svar. Gå til Commits i Bitbucket. I rullemenuen øverst på siden, hvis du ikke kan se linket Vis alle ved siden af ​​rullemenuen, skal du klikke på en af ​​grenene i din liste over grene i rullemenuen.

Hvordan tagger man en commit? For at oprette et Git-tag til en specifik commit, skal du bruge "git tag"-kommandoen med tag-navnet og commit SHA for det tag, der skal oprettes. Hvis du vil oprette et kommenteret tag til en specifik commit, kan du bruge "-a" og "-m" mulighederne, vi beskrev i det foregående afsnit.

Hvordan ser jeg git-tags? Find det seneste tilgængelige Git-tag

For at finde det seneste Git-tag, der er tilgængeligt på dit lager, skal du bruge kommandoen "git describe" med "–tags"-indstillingen. På denne måde vil du blive præsenteret for det tag, der er forbundet med den seneste commit af din nuværende checkede filial.

Hvad er tagging i bitbucket? – Yderligere spørgsmål

Er git-tags unikke?

Tags er fuldstændig adskilt fra grene, så hvordan du vælger at håndtere tags afhænger ikke af hvordan du vælger at håndtere grene. Du kan anvende et tag på gren E' og sikkert slette test_branch uden at miste koden i E'.

Er git-tags uforanderlige?

Er Git-tags uforanderlige? Ja, Git Tags er uforanderlige, og når de først er oprettet, kan de ikke ændres. Du skal slette tagget og genskabe det, selvom tagget kan opdatere til en anden commit.

Hvad er et git tag vs branch?

Et tag repræsenterer en version af en bestemt gren på et tidspunkt. En gren repræsenterer en separat udviklingstråd, der kan køre sideløbende med andre udviklingsindsatser på den samme kodebase. Ændringer til en gren kan i sidste ende blive flettet tilbage til en anden gren for at forene dem.

Hvordan skubber jeg et fjernmærke?

Skub alle git-tags til fjernbetjeningen

Og hvis du vil skubbe alle tags fra din lokale til fjernbetjeningen, skal du tilføje "–tags" til git-kommandoen, og den vil skubbe alle tags til fjernbetjeningen.

Tagger du før eller efter commit?

1 svar. Du kan tagge en revision lige efter din commit eller senere (efter et push). Derefter kan du pushe dit tag med: git push origin [tagname] .

Er git-tags branchespecifikke?

Her er en anden måde at udtrykke det på: Et tag er en pointer til en commit, og commits eksisterer uafhængigt af brancher. Det er vigtigt at forstå, at tags ikke har noget direkte forhold til filialer - de identificerer kun en commit.

Hvordan fjerner man et tag?

Android & iOS App

Find det indlæg, du vil fjerne tagget fra, og vælg derefter pilen ved siden af ​​det. Tryk på "Rapportér/fjern tag". Vælg årsagen. Jeg plejer bare at gå med "Jeg er på dette billede, og jeg kan ikke lide det".

Hvordan viser jeg alle tags?

List tags med navne, der matcher det givne mønster (eller alle, hvis der ikke er angivet noget mønster). Hvis du skriver "git tag" uden argumenter, vises også alle tags.

Kan en git-commit have flere tags?

Vi har nogle gange to tags på samme commit. Når vi bruger git describe til den commit, returnerer git describe altid det første tag. Min læsning af git-describe man-siden synes at indikere, at det andet tag skal returneres (hvilket giver mere mening).

Hvad pusher alle tags?

for at skubbe alle tags (eller git push – tags for at skubbe til standard fjernbetjening, normalt oprindelse ). Dette er meget tilsigtet adfærd, for at gøre push-tags eksplicit. Pushing tags bør normalt være et bevidst valg.

Bliver tags flettet Git?

Sikkert. Filialnavne, tagnavne og andre navne tjener til at lokalisere en bestemt commit. Du kan gå direkte til den commit ved at bruge det navn. Selve forpligtelsen vil blive bevaret i det Git-lager, så længe selve navnet fortsætter med at eksistere.

Hvad er Git rebase vs merge?

Git rebase og merge integrerer begge ændringer fra en gren til en anden. Git rebase flytter en featuregren til en master. Git merge tilføjer en ny commit, der bevarer historien.

Hvad er release tag?

Et tag er et git-koncept, mens en udgivelse er et GitHub-koncept på et højere niveau. Som angivet i det officielle meddelelsesindlæg fra GitHub-bloggen: "Udgivelser er førsteklasses objekter med changelogs og binære aktiver, der præsenterer en komplet projekthistorie ud over Git-artefakter."

Er git-tags permanente?

Er git-tags permanente?

Hvad er forskellen mellem tag og branch?

Både grene og tags er i det væsentlige pejlemærker til commits. Den store forskel er, at commit en branch peger på ændringer, når du tilføjer nye commits, og et tag fryses til en bestemt commit for at markere et tidspunkt som havende en vis betydning.

Hvorfor har vi brug for tag i Git?

Git-tags er som milepæle, markører eller et specifikt punkt i repo's historie markeret som betydningsfuldt. Tags bruges normalt til at markere stabile udgivelser eller opnåelse af meget vigtige milepæle. Tags kan hjælpe brugerne af repoen til nemt at navigere til de vigtige dele af kodehistorikken som frigivelsespunkter.

Kan jeg oprette en filial fra et tag?

Den bedste måde at arbejde med git-tags på er at oprette en ny gren fra det eksisterende tag. Det kan gøres ved hjælp af git checkout-kommandoen.

Hvad er git flow model?

Gitflow Workflow definerer en streng forgreningsmodel designet omkring projektudgivelsen. I stedet tildeler den meget specifikke roller til forskellige grene og definerer, hvordan og hvornår de skal interagere. Ud over featuregrene bruger den individuelle filialer til at forberede, vedligeholde og optage udgivelser.

Hvad gør git commit?

Git commit-kommandoen er en af ​​de primære kernefunktioner i Git. Forudgående brug af git add-kommandoen er påkrævet for at vælge de ændringer, der vil blive iscenesat til næste commit. Derefter bruges git commit til at skabe et øjebliksbillede af de iscenesatte ændringer langs en tidslinje af et Git-projekts historie.

Hvordan kan vi finde en bestemt git-commit?

At finde en Git-commit efter kontrolsum, størrelse eller nøjagtig fil

En af de "hoved" filer i depotet, der ofte ændres, er dit bedste bud på dette. Du kan bede brugeren om størrelsen eller blot en kontrolsum af filen og derefter se, hvilke repository-commits der har en matchende post.

$config[zx-auto] not found$config[zx-overlay] not found